About

Dr. Guangfen Wei is a pioneering researcher at the intersection of robotics, sensor systems, and biomimetic communication. Her work focuses on two key areas: developing robust multi-sensor platforms for mobile robots operating in extreme environments, and advancing the emerging field of infochemical communication. In her most impactful work (20 citations), Dr. Wei designed and implemented a novel multi-sensor module for mobile robots deployed in hazardous firefighting and search-and-rescue scenarios. By drawing ambient air into internal chambers via a micro air pump, this system enables robots to evaluate critical environmental parameters, significantly enhancing their situational awareness in harsh conditions. Her second major contribution (10 citations) explores the frontier of biosynthetic infochemical communication—using molecular compounds for information transmission. Dr. Wei’s ratiometric decoding approach for pheromones represents a breakthrough in biomimetic communication, with potential applications ranging from pest management to coordinating swarms of autonomous robots.
